Career path

Career Role Description
Edge Computing Security Engineer Designs, implements, and manages security solutions for edge devices and networks, preventing security incidents at the network's edge. High demand for expertise in IoT security and network protocols.
Cloud Security Architect (Edge Focus) Develops and maintains secure cloud architectures with a strong emphasis on edge computing, incorporating security best practices into edge deployments. Requires deep understanding of hybrid cloud security.
Cybersecurity Analyst (Edge Devices) Monitors and analyzes security threats targeting edge devices and networks. Focuses on incident response and proactive threat hunting in edge environments.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ills are vital.
IoT Security Specialist (Edge Computing) Specializes in securing Internet of Things (IoT) devices deployed at the edge. Focuses on device security, data encryption, and secure communication protocols in edge environments.

Edge computing, processing data closer to its source, offers a crucial advantage in security. By reducing latency and network dependencies, it facilitates faster threat detection and response.
